Solr data import handler mysql download

Uploading structured data store data with the data import. How to add mysql data import handler for apache solr. Importingindexing database mysql or sql server in solr using data import handler install solr download and install solr from you can access solr. First thing to understand is to fill the index of solr, i use the dataimporthandler of solr. You can import documents basic entities in solr, compared to rdbms those would be rows in table to solr from a multitude of sources, but the most popular use case is to store text data i. Loading data from sql server to solr with a data import handler. Add comments here to get more clarity or context around a question. How to call stored procedure from solr phaneendras weblog.

Check your data import handler configuration it looks like 7 rows from db was fetched, but they didnt create a solr document. Indexing mysql utf8 data in solr 4 using dataimporthandler i have a setup where i have a mysql db using amazons rds version 5. Feb 10, 2016 your are missing one step in point number 8. For mysql driver, which doesnt honor fetchsize and pulls whole resultset. If you want to take advantage of solr data import handler to index the data, but unable to find a way to call oracle stored procedure or a function, here you go.

Work with data import handler to index data from a. Solr recognizes plurals and similar words like read, reading or a data, adata etc. Mar 26, 2020 mcafee network security manager nsm 9. To import data from sql server database you need to use apache solrs data import handler. Copy file from the downloaded archive mysqlconnectorjava. Jul 08, 2017 solr data import handler dih provides a mechanism for importing content from a data store and indexing it. When i am trying to use database importer using solr admin ui for the core i have created, required data are facing from oracle database, but data are not getting indexed. Please suggest me how to import data from csv and mysql table at the same time. Apache solr solr mysql data import recently i wrote a blog post on how to install and configure solr. This interactive session will help you launch a solrcloud cluster on your local workstation. The data is taken from the file specified by an external entity using a data source. The dataimporthandler is a solr contrib that p rovides a configuration driven way to import this data into solr in both f ull builds and using incremental delta imports. Nov 15, 2017 to import data from sql server database you need to use apache solrs data import handler. Sqltonosqlimporter is a solr like data import handler to import sql mysql,oracle,postgresql data to nosql systems mongodb,couchdb,elastic search.

The data import handler dih provides a mechanism for importing content from a data store and indexing it. Data import handler import from solr xml files solr. Here, we are going to configure data import handler to import the data, request handler and the response handler. Solr includes a tool called the data import handler. Now we are done with mysql, lets move ahead to the solr. The dataimporthandler is a solr contrib that provides a configuration driven way to import. Apr, 2017 the request handler class for the data import request handler is org. These can be used to index data from a database or structured.

Loading data from sql server to solr with a data import. Dataimporthandler solr request handler for data import from databases and rest data sources. In \dist make sure you have dataimporter and mysqlconnector solrdataimporthandler4. Stores all configuration information for pulling and indexing data. User is expected to write a configuration, this tool will export the data to the preferred nosql system. If you dont feel like creating your own data importer to import data from your sql database to your solr collections, weve also integrated the dih data import handler which now helps you define your sql connection and query, and import your data to solr with just a few clicks. Uploading structured data store data with the data import handler many search applications store the content to be indexed in a structured data store, such as a relational database. Solr builds on lucene, an open source java library that provides indexing and search technology, as well as spellchecking, hit highlighting and advanced analysistokenization capabilities. How to use the solr data import handler to index a mysql.

To help you get started, we put together this tutorial on how you can import data from sql server in to apache solr for indexing using data import handler via jdbc. You can now check that after the import solr contains data you expect. This first post in a two part series will show that apache solr is a robust and versatile alternative that makes indexing an sql database just as easy. Importingindexing database mysql or sql server in solr.

The data import handler uses spark sql, and you can read the spark sql reference for full details on the supported sql. You might need to download and install the oracle jdbc driver in the lib directory of. Uploading structured data store data with the data import handler. In addition to having plugins for importing rich documents using tika or from structured data sources using the data import handler, solr natively supports indexing structured documents in xml, csv and json. I have configure solr search on my local system, but didnt able to find a way to connect it with exist database on mysql need you suggestion. How to install solr on ubuntu with mysql data import. May 30, 2016 importingindexing database mysql or sql server in solr using data import handler install solr download and install solr from you can access solr admin from your browser. Import sql server data into apache solr using data import.

I know this question is old but i have recently had an occasion to set it up and had similar problems using bitnami windows. Therefore solr returns more efficient search results. Aug 16, 2011 negativ about solr 16 august 2011 19 december 2018 apache solr, data import handler, dih, import 5 comments so far, in previous articles, we looked at the import data from sql databases. Apache solr reference guide this reference guide describes apache solr, the open source solution for search.

Import sql server data into apache solr using data import handler. Indexing database mysql or sql server in solr technology. If you want to take advantage of solr data import handler to index the data, but unable to find a way to call oracle stored procedure or a function, here you go solution. Dec 17, 2015 solr has a schemaless mode, where you dont need to create a schema defining mappings for your fields beforehand solr will infer the best mapping based on the first data it sees.

Apache solr indexing using data import handler smart. We can also configure multiple datastore and indexing it. Thanks to few xml lines of code you are able to import data from sql server to solr without the need to write a single line of code. A list of sql functions is available in raw api docs. This tutorial assumes that you have already mongodb collection and you also have setup your solr and solr index file directory where you want to keep your solr indexes. Importingindexing database mysql or sql server in solr using data import handler 00. The dataimporthandler is a solr contrib that provides a configuration driven way to import this data into solr in both full builds and using incremental delta imports. I can insert and select the chinese characters using php. Work with data import handler to index data from a database.

Notice that two instances of solr have started on two nodes. Data import handler how to import data from sql databases part 1. Most websites use a mysql database to store its data and standard mysql search using sql or fulltext searching by mysql. Solr data import handler dih provides a mechanism for importing content from a data store and indexing it. The data import handler is a way of importing data from a database using jdbc drivers and indexing it. Dataimporthandler does not directly support calling regular stored procedures. Get to know the basic features of solr indexing and the analyzerstokenizers available. How to use the solr data import handler to index a mysql table.

Solr like data import handler to migrate data from sql systems to nosql eliasahsqltonosqlimporter. The second will go deeper into how to make leverage solrs features to create a. Solr index document from database data import handler. How to add mysql data import handler for apache solr by shay anderson on july 2011 knowledge base linux how to add mysql data import handler for apache solr.

In my case, i work with mysql download the jdbc driver for mysql from. Solr index document from database data import handler java. Contribute to jas502ncve 20190193 development by creating an account on github. Indexing oracle database table data in apache solr 5. Data import handler how to import data from sql databases. But with apachesolr we can not only search but also improve the search results. The configuration of the data import handler is given below. Network security manager has transitioned from mysql to mariadb. The request handler class for the data import request handler is org. This tutorial was written for beginner java developers and is meant to quickly set you up with solr. Find out how to install apache solr on ubuntu with mysql data import. At the beginning of this year christopher vig wrote a great post about indexing an sql database to the internets current search engine du jour, elasticsearch.

While i am planning to write series of posts on solr, i found it important to provide few extra details about spell checker, dataimporthandler and other similar areas which is not covered in the post. Most applications store data in relational databases or xml files and searching over such data is a common usecase. I have confirmed that the db is configured for utf8. Uploading data with index handlers index handlers are request handlers designed to add, delete and update documents to the index. How to import data from mysql into the network security. Apache solr reference guide apache solr reference guide 7. Ive set the following steps up in the configurations. This article is a step by step tutorial on how to get solr 6. Jun 24, 2016 till now we have seen how to install and configure apache solr, now it is time to import your mysql database into solr for searching and indexing. Solr import data with oracle db cloudera community. In \dist make sure you have dataimporter and mysqlconnector solr dataimporthandler4. Solr recognizes plurals and similar words like read, reading or adata, adata etc. To import application alerts from application event tables from the mysql database, into the solr database, run the following script. Apache solr solr mysql data import experimental life.

261 404 698 291 772 1626 742 435 1160 1561 335 986 1104 445 1130 1060 706 479 662 1541 1204 157 932 694 1605 69 292 1102 1227 485 458 353 215 470 533 15 1146 825 1319 892 983 1067 956 567 1038 246 955